Hi Shahoodu Hi. The notification is part of the New Page Curation process. The "review" is primarily to weed out unencyclopedic new pages and also to ensure new pages meet a minimum standard (are referenced, added to categories etc). There is no written review as such and if there are any shortcomings on the page then a suitable tag is added. Regards. --John B123 (talk) 15:54, 31 July 2020 (UTC)

Hi Riseley, Thanks. Normally if you want to talk to a person directly you use their talk page, if it's a general comment about an article that is not directed at a specific person then use the article's talk page. If you reply to somebody on an article talk page then prefix your reply with{{reply|their username}} so they get a notification they have a message. (no need to do that on an editors talk page as they get a notification whenever anything is posted on the page).
I've added some categories to Thomas Kiernan (biographer). The "Biography" section needs referencing. Generally you need to add a reference at the end of each paragraph. Regards --John B123 (talk) 23:38, 2 August 2020 (UTC)

Copyvio speedy deletion tags

Hi John B123! I see that you tagged and then later untagged the page Wembley or Bust as a copyvio. Firstly, thanks for your vigilance in finding copyvios like this. However, in future please can I ask you to replace the speedy tags with a {{copyvio-revdel}} tag instead of removing it completely after the copyvio content has been removed from the latest revision? That way, admins are still alerted to remove the relevant edits from the page history as well.

I've revdelled the specific revisions from the page history now, so don't worry about this article. Cheers! stwalkerster (talk) 13:26, 3 August 2020 (UTC)
